Chinese Architecture and the Beaux-Arts Spatial Habitus: Making and Meaning in Asia's Architecture Introduction: In the early 20th century, Chinese traditional architecture and French-derived methods of the Ecole des Beaux-Arts converged in the United States when Chinese students were given scholarships to train as architects at American universities. These graduates returned home in the 1920s and 1930s and began practicing architecture, transferring a version of what they had learned in the US to Chinese situations. This convergence had significant implications for China between 1911 and 1949, as it underwent cataclysmic social, economic, and political changes. After 1949, China experienced a radically different wave of influence from the Beaux-Arts through advisors from the Soviet Union, first under Stalin and later Khrushchev, bringing Beaux-Arts ideals in the guise of socialist progress. In the early 21st century, China is still feeling the effects of these events. Section 1: Convergence of Chinese Architecture and the Ecole des Beaux-Arts This section outlines the salient aspects of Chinese architecture and the Ecole des Beaux-Arts, explaining how and why the two systems met in the US. It explores the historical context of Chinese architecture and its evolution, highlighting the significance of the Beaux-Arts method in shaping modern Chinese architecture.
